Soil can be in a variety of forms, including clay, chalky, loam, and sandy soils. It is important to choose the right plant for the type of soil you have in your garden. You also need to think about differing drainage and nutrients within soil. Choosing the right plants for your garden, enriching the soil each year with compost, create an environment where plants are healthier, and therefore more pest-resistance. 

Below are some useful links to soil information and advice: